NCBI Summary for NFAM1
The protein encoded by this gene is a type I membrane receptor that activates cytokine gene promoters such as the IL-13 and TNF-alpha promoters. The encoded protein contains an immunoreceptor tyrosine-based activation motif (ITAM) and is thought to regulate the signaling and development of B-cells.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]
UniProt Comments for NFAM1
Function: May function in immune system as a receptor which activates via the calcineurin/NFAT-signaling pathway the downstream cytokine gene promoters. Activates the transcription of IL-13 and TNF-alpha promoters. May be involved in the regulation of B-cell, but not T-cell, development. Overexpression activates downstream effectors without ligand binding or antibody cross-linking. Ref.1 Ref.2
Subunit structure: No direct interaction with the B-cell antigen receptor (BCR). Interacts with SYK; probably involved in BCR signaling. Interacts with ZAP70
By similarity. Ref.2
Subcellular location: Cell membrane; Single-pass type I membrane protein
By similarity. Note: Partially recruited to lipid rafts upon BCR stimulation
By similarity. Ref.1 Ref.2
Tissue specificity: Highly expressed in neutrophils, primary monocytes, mast cells, monocytic cell lines and lymphocytes. Also expressed in spleen B and T-cells, and lung. Expressed at low level in non-immune tissue. Ref.1 Ref.2
Domain: The ITAM domain displays no close similarity to any existing ITAMs, except for four conserved positions. The phosphorylated ITAM domain binds ZAP70 and SYK.
Post-translational modification: N-glycosylated. Ref.2
Sequence similarities: Contains 1 Ig-like V-type (immunoglobulin-like) domain.Contains 1 ITAM domain.
